Rularea Python pe ChromeOS

Este posibil să rulați interpretul Python pe o mașină ChromeOS? Am găsit diverși editori pe care îi poți folosi, dar aș dori posibilitatea de a rula și aplicații python.

Aș dori să cumpăr Samsung Chromebook și, fiind student la informatică, mi-ar plăcea să pot să-mi fac temele CS în loc să-mi port Macbook-ul de 15 inci sau Toshiba.

Răspuns

Python Shell

Puteți instala acest plugin, Python Shell în Chrome. Iată câteva informații din acea pagină cu informații despre extensii din magazin:

Shell Python pentru browserul dvs.
Un shell Python pentru Chrome.

Caracteristici:

  • Python 2.7
  • Ruby 1.8
  • JavaScript

Acestea sunt singurele limbi care au fost compilate în prezent în JavaScript de proiectul jsrepl ca de data aceasta.

Mod dezvoltator

Alternativ, puteți să vă puneți dispozitivul în Mod dezvoltator și să obțineți acces la un shell de unde puteți instala / lansa Python.

Interpretul Skulpt

În cele din urmă puteți consulta Interpretul Skulpt . Site principal „s aici .

Skulpt este o implementare integrată în browser a Python.

Crouton

Puteți instala un Linux complet pe hardware-ul Chromebook folosind proiectul Crouton .

crouton este un set de scripturi care se grupează într-un generator de chroot centrat pe OS, ușor de utilizat. În prezent, Ubuntu și Debian sunt acceptate (folosind debootstrap în spatele scenei), dar „Chromium OS Debian, Ubuntu și probabil alte distracții în cele din urmă Chroot Environment” nu se mai acronimizează (crodupodece este, desigur, destul de amuzant de spus, totuși).

Există un tutorial ușor de urmat despre Life Hacker care vă conduce prin instalare și configurare, intitulat: Cum să instalați Linux pe un Chromebook și să-i deblocați întregul potențial .

Ce cale să mergeți?

Dacă sunteți serios cu privire la utilizarea hardware-ului Chromebook ca casetă de dezvoltare Aș merge cu Crouton. Celelalte opțiuni vă oferă doar bucăți de Python. Dacă sunteți serios să faceți o dezvoltare reală, aceasta este într-adevăr singura opțiune.

Comentarii

  • La fel și croutonul rulează cu chromeos sau trebuie să îl lansați separat.
  • @RyanDawkins – Dacă urmați ghidul Life Hacker, puteți rula Crouton deasupra ChromeOS într-un chroot envi ronment. en.wikipedia.org/wiki/Chroot .
  • Python Shell este acum până la versiunea 3.3. În plus, ar trebui să adăugați avertismente cu privire la efectele secundare ale rularii Chromebookului în modul dezvoltator.
  • Pluginul Python Shell pentru Chrome este foarte limitat, iar dezvoltatorul nu a răspuns la întrebări de peste 2 ani. Cred că ' a murit, Jim.

Răspunde

O alternativă bună ar fi utilizarea unui mediu de dezvoltare cloud, cum ar fi Codevny sau Cloud9.

Acestea au multe avantaje față de instalațiile locale bazate pe fișiere (așa cum este descris în detaliu pe paginile lor) și sunt mai aliniate cu întregul concept de sistem de operare Chrome, adică dispozitivul local ar trebui să fie slab, ieftin (dar confortabil!) și potențial de unică folosință (ca în cazul în care vărsați un latte pe el sau cineva îl fură, nu-i bine, primiți unul nou și continuați-vă munca neîntrerupt).

Ele oferă, de asemenea, prețuri competitive pentru tipurile de sarcini de lucru de care are nevoie un student (de exemplu, puteți plăti ~ 0-20 de dolari pe lună pentru o sarcină de lucru suficient de grea necesară pentru toate exercițiile dvs. (de obicei, aceștia nu au nevoie de mult RAM, sau oricum rulează 24/7).

Ca un beneficiu secundar, înveți să folosești și tipurile de instrumente care devin indispensabile în munca dezvoltatorilor moderni care implică scala colaborativă p proiectele, deoarece instalațiile localhost sunt notoriu greu de replicat (pentru o opinie oarecum părtinitoare asupra acestuia, aruncați o privire aici ).

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*